Lonnie L. Murphy Jr. 1963-2010 SPRINGFIELD - Lonnie Lee Murphy Jr., 46, of 254 Quincy St., went to be with the Lord on Saturday, February 20, 2010, at Baystate Medical Center. Born in Springfield, he was a son of Betty Ruth (Neeley) Murphy and the late Lonnie Lee Murphy Sr. He graduated from...
